Are You Ready to Serve on the Bright Lights Board of Directors?

Besides our amazing office and summer staff, we have another group that works hard for us: Our board members!

The Bright Lights board of directors is made up of people from our community who share our mission for offering hands-on summer learning to K-8th grade students. They volunteer their time and talents to Bright Lights throughout the year.

What is involved in being a Bright Lights board member?

  • Agreeing to a three-year term.
  • Attending six board meetings a year for approximately 1 hour each.
  • Serving on one Bright Lights committee, which meets approximately 6 to 8 times a year.
  • Participating in all Bright Lights events and using both your time and treasures to support the fundraising efforts of Bright Lights.
